Widespread Sleep Concerns in Seniors and How They Affect Quality of Life
Sleep problems are a widespread concern among seniors, substantially affecting their overall health and quality of life. Common issues include insomnia, sleep apnea, and restless leg syndrome, each causing fragmented sleep patterns. Insomnia may result from various factors, including medications, chronic pain, or anxiety, resulting in daytime fatigue and cognitive decline. Sleep apnea, characterized by interrupted breathing during sleep, can result in serious health complications such as cardiovascular problems and increased risk of falls. Restless leg syndrome often presents with uncomfortable sensations in the legs, prompting frequent movement that disrupts restful sleep. These disturbances not only reduce physical well-being but also exacerbate emotional challenges, such as depression and anxiety. Consequently, managing sleep issues in seniors is crucial for advancing their overall quality of life, ensuring they remain engaged and active in their daily activities. Variable Height Mechanism
An adjustable height mechanism stands as an essential feature in senior care mattresses, significantly improving ease of use and convenience. This mechanism allows care staff to readily adjust the bed's elevation, facilitating secure movement for both patients and staff. By reducing the bed, individuals can get in and out with little effort, decreasing the risk of falls. Alternatively, elevating the bed helps caregivers in completing work without too much stooping or strain, thereby promoting proper body mechanics. The ability to customize height not only supports independence for the elderly but also meets various medical needs, ensuring that the bed can adjust to varying circumstances. In summary, this capability considerably contributes to a safer and more comfortable care environment for the elderly.
Load Relief Mattresses
Promoting relaxation and reducing pressure sores, pressure relief mattresses are vital parts of elderly care beds. These specialized mattresses distribute body weight evenly, reducing pressure points that can lead to skin breakdown. Made from state-of-the-art materials like memory foam or gel-infused layers, they adapt to the contours of the body, ensuring a comfortable sleeping surface. Additionally, many pressure relief mattresses feature adjustable firmness levels, allowing caregivers to customize support based on individual needs. The breathable fabric enhances airflow, promoting a cooler sleep environment while minimizing moisture buildup.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ning and replacing worn-out mattresses, is essential to maintain their effectiveness. Overall, pressure relief mattresses greatly contribute to the overall well-being and comfort of elderly patients.
Supportive Side Rails designed to ensure secure positioning and comfort
Supportive side rails are crucial components of elderly care beds, providing vital security and comfort for patients. These rails are engineered to avoid falls, offering stability when patients adjust themselves or get in and out of bed. They also function as handholds, assisting individuals with limited mobility. Many models include adjustable heights, enabling caregivers to customize the rails to meet individual needs effectively. Additionally, some side rails come with built-in storage options for personal items, enhancing convenience. The use of padded materials can further increase comfort, reducing the risk of injury from accidental bumps. Overall, supportive side rails considerably contribute to a safe and comfortable environment, guaranteeing that elderly patients can maintain their independence while receiving necessary care.

Picking the Best Mattress for Older Adult Comfort
What criteria must be assessed when choosing a mattress for seniors? Comfort and support are paramount, as older adults often endure joint pain and other health issues. A mattress offering adequate pressure relief can improve sleep quality and diminish discomfort. Also, firmness level is noteworthy; a medium-firm mattress typically maintains a blend between support and cushioning.
Temperature management is yet another important aspect, as seniors may be more sensitive to heat. How Can I Decide the Suitable Bed Position for My Older Loved One?
Figuring out the best bed height for an elderly loved one involves measuring their knee height when seated. The bed should present comfortable entry for moving in and out, ensuring safety and comfort during use.
